Who Killed Rosanne Boyland? Family Seeking For Answers For Their Daughter's Death In Capitol Riot



Rosanne Boyland was one of three persons who died after being trampled during the Capitol riots on January 6, 2021.

Rosanne Boyland was from Kennesaw, Georgia. She was unmarried and considered a wonderful and dedicated aunt by family members. She was seen frequently babysitting her friends' children or picking up her nieces from school.

Intimates describe her as caring, sensitive, and close to her parents and siblings. She also had a history of opiate and heroin addiction, and she often attended meetings to help her with drug abuse concerns.

She had done odd jobs throughout the years, but it was difficult for her to get stable work since she had an arrest record, including a felony conviction for a drug-related violation. She was mostly unemployed and lived with her parents.

Podcast: Who Killed Rosanne Boyland?

Rosanne Boyland was alleged to have been trampled to death during the violent rioting at the US Capitol on January 6, 2021. The bands of pro-Trump insurgents attempted and failed to disrupt the declaration of President Joe Biden's victory.

MSNBC anchor Ayman Mohyeldin and producer Preeti Varathan launched the popular podcast 'American Radical' in December. The program delved into the little-known story of Rosanne Boyland, one of three individuals killed in the rampage.

The New York Times reported mere days after the insurgency that Boyland "appears to have been slain in a crush of fellow rioters during their effort to fight past a police line, according to recordings obtained by The Times."

According to the Times, the chief medical examiner in DC at the time stated that Boyland's cause and manner of death were "pending."

Rosanne Boyland Family Asks Answers For Her Death In Capitol Riot

Rosanne Boyland's family ask for answers about her death in the Capitol riot, as early reports stated she was crushed to death amid the throng.

However, the DC medical examiner finally determined that her death was caused by an amphetamine overdose.

The Washington Post originally reported on April 7, 2021, that Boyland's death was caused by "accidental acute amphetamine poisoning" by the DC medical examiner.

Rosanne Boyland Parents Today

Rosanne Boyland's parents reportedly begged her not to attend the riot on the day she died. Her family is currently residing in Kennesaw, Georgia.

During a violent battle between protesters and police, Boyland was forced to the ground and crushed, according to a friend who was with her.

However, her sister stated that a police investigator informed the family that Boyland fainted while standing off to the side in the Capitol Rotunda.

Cave, Boyland's sister, stated that her sister had no intention of committing violence when she flew to Washington.

Similarly, she joined the conspiracy group QAnon and refused to accept that Joe Biden had defeated President Trump.
